Re: black foam in coolant after top end rebuild

Looks like someone put some "stopleak" type product in it before and now its coming back to bite you. My suggestion would be a coolant flush and possibly even removal of the lower block freeze plugs to check for gunk and remove as needed. Pretty common to see a bunch of gunk in the block, especially if the engine wasn't taken well care of. But the bubbles coming up to the top of the radiator while the engine is running is interesting. Have you preformed a cooling system pressure test after replacing the cylinder head gaskets?

